#e210c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e210cc is composed of 88.6% red, 6.3%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 306.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 47.5%. #e210c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#c50099.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#e210c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e210cc has RGB values of R:226, G:16,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.1,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14815436.

Shades and Tints of #e210c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060006 is the darkest color, while #fef3fd is the lightest one.
